Output 153def8b54859d547d12b4fa3ea7cbaf6cc1e63e05e62e43ae90c097739d0ac9:0

value
1602626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2a41e96d24683894e538910fa6a9792296b652 OP_EQUAL
address
3PDk1v5y84yPCcCQ9mXFg261A2gPQFNEus
transaction
153def8b54859d547d12b4fa3ea7cbaf6cc1e63e05e62e43ae90c097739d0ac9
spent
true